Output 6903dc9e4e4ae67cae37a5d7b6f969b0aeb1efe3eba290fc33cd6c1530065536:0

value
21886666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e80669edd9dfaf50f5397d7a8721e5fa8b1d86c2 OP_EQUAL
address
3NqrNgk7HQdhFeBkvxiTeRYmaFXER6FX6k
transaction
6903dc9e4e4ae67cae37a5d7b6f969b0aeb1efe3eba290fc33cd6c1530065536
spent
true